Recipe ingredients

  • Recipe Split pea soup for 6 people:
  • 500 g split peas
  • 2 carrots
  • 1 leek
  • 2 onions
  • 2 cloves garlic
  • 1 Morteau sausage
  • 2 strips of pork belly
  • 20 cl of liquid cream.

Instructions

  1. Pour the cream into the siphon.
  2. Shake and put in the refrigerator.
  3. Peel the carrots then cut them into slices.
  4. Peel the onion, cut in half and then into small cubes.
  5. Peel the garlic.
  6. Peel the leek and cut in half.
  7. Place all the vegetables in a large saucepan.
  8. Add the Morteau sausage without piercing it.
  9. Add the bacon strips.
  10. Cover with plenty of water.
  11. Add whole peeled garlic.
  12. Salt and pepper
  13. Cook for about 45 minutes.
  14. Remove some of the liquid.
  15. Remove the sausage and pork belly.
  16. Mix and add the liquid as you go.
  17. Serve hot with a small salted whipped cream.
  18. Cut a slice of Morteau per person.

Preparation time: 20 minutes
Cooking time: 45 minutes
Number of people: 4
